"""WebSocket client for the CricketCaptain environment."""

from typing import Any, Dict

from openenv.core import EnvClient
from openenv.core.client_types import StepResult

try:
    from .models import CricketAction, CricketObservation, CricketState
except ImportError:
    from models import CricketAction, CricketObservation, CricketState


class CricketCaptainEnv(EnvClient[CricketAction, CricketObservation, CricketState]):
    def _step_payload(self, action: CricketAction) -> Dict[str, Any]:
        return {"tool": action.tool, "arguments": action.arguments}

    def _parse_result(self, payload: Dict[str, Any]) -> StepResult[CricketObservation]:
        obs_data = payload.get("observation", payload)
        observation = CricketObservation(
            game_context=obs_data.get("game_context", {}),
            declared_strategy=obs_data.get("declared_strategy", {}),
            bowling_strategy=obs_data.get("bowling_strategy", {}),
            field_setting=obs_data.get("field_setting", "Balanced"),
            strategic_phase=obs_data.get("strategic_phase", "pre_ball"),
            current_batter=obs_data.get("current_batter", {}),
            current_bowler=obs_data.get("current_bowler", {}),
            opponent_context=obs_data.get("opponent_context", {}),
            opponent_plan=obs_data.get("opponent_plan", {}),
            last_outcome=obs_data.get("last_outcome", {}),
            eval_pack_id=obs_data.get("eval_pack_id", "default"),
            game_state=obs_data.get("game_state", "batting"),
            available_tools=obs_data.get("available_tools", []),
            tool_history=obs_data.get("tool_history", []),
            last_ball_result=obs_data.get("last_ball_result", ""),
            prompt_text=obs_data.get("prompt_text", ""),
            target=obs_data.get("target"),
            innings_type=obs_data.get("innings_type", "first"),
            curriculum_stage=obs_data.get("curriculum_stage", 1),
            done=payload.get("done", False),
            reward=payload.get("reward"),
            metadata=obs_data.get("metadata", {}),
        )
        return StepResult(
            observation=observation,
            reward=payload.get("reward"),
            done=payload.get("done", False),
        )

    def _parse_state(self, payload: Dict[str, Any]) -> CricketState:
        return CricketState(
            episode_id=payload.get("episode_id"),
            step_count=payload.get("step_count", 0),
            game_state=payload.get("game_state", "batting"),
            phase=payload.get("phase", "powerplay"),
            total_score=payload.get("total_score", 0),
            wickets_lost=payload.get("wickets_lost", 0),
            over=payload.get("over", 0),
            ball=payload.get("ball", 0),
            target=payload.get("target"),
            match_result=payload.get("match_result", ""),
            reward_breakdown=payload.get("reward_breakdown", {}),
            innings_rewards=payload.get("innings_rewards", []),
            toss_winner=payload.get("toss_winner"),
            toss_decision=payload.get("toss_decision"),
            innings_type=payload.get("innings_type", "first"),
            coherence_scores=payload.get("coherence_scores", []),
            adaptation_scores=payload.get("adaptation_scores", []),
            opponent_awareness_scores=payload.get("opponent_awareness_scores", []),
            regret_scores=payload.get("regret_scores", []),
            tool_calls_made=payload.get("tool_calls_made", 0),
            analyze_calls=payload.get("analyze_calls", []),
            tool_history=payload.get("tool_history", []),
            transcript=payload.get("transcript", []),
            dls_par=payload.get("dls_par", 250.0),
            strategy_changes=payload.get("strategy_changes", 0),
            last_strategy_set_over=payload.get("last_strategy_set_over", -1),
            last_reflection=payload.get("last_reflection", ""),
            eval_pack_id=payload.get("eval_pack_id", "default"),
            opponent_mode=payload.get("opponent_mode", "heuristic"),
            strategic_phase=payload.get("strategic_phase", "pre_ball"),
            shot_plan=payload.get("shot_plan", {}),
            delivery_plan=payload.get("delivery_plan", {}),
            opponent_plan=payload.get("opponent_plan", {}),
            last_outcome=payload.get("last_outcome", {}),
            current_batter=payload.get("current_batter", {}),
            current_bowler=payload.get("current_bowler", {}),
            is_done=payload.get("is_done", False),
            curriculum_stage=payload.get("curriculum_stage", 1),
            max_overs=payload.get("max_overs", 50),
            match_plan=payload.get("match_plan", {}),
            plan_commitment_scores=payload.get("plan_commitment_scores", []),
            plan_staleness_penalties=payload.get("plan_staleness_penalties", []),
            plan_freshness_scores=payload.get("plan_freshness_scores", []),
        )
